- class PayloadAprilTagApproachParams#
Bases:
vehicle_common.mode_loader.ParamsBase- tag_id: int | None = None#
- tag_size_m: float = 0.0508#
- tag_family: str = 'tag36h11'#
- max_forward_speed: float = 0.2#
- forward_gain: float = 0.5#
- angular_gain: float = 0.003#
- yaw_gain: float = 0.0#
- stop_distance_m: float = 0.2#
- tag_lost_coast_s: float = 0.5#
- compressed: bool = False#
- completion_state: str = 'done'#
